### **Pros and Cons of Buying a Used Rexroth Indramat HT-S11 R911317709-07 Circuit Board (Bosch Servo Drive)**
#### **Pros**
1. **Cost Savings** Purchasing a used or refurbished circuit board is significantly cheaper than buying a new one from the manufacturer, especially for high-end industrial components like Rexroth/Bosch servo drives.
2. **Functional Reliability (If Tested)** If the board has been professionally inspected, tested, and verified to work, it can provide the same performance as a new unit, avoiding downtime in critical applications.
3. **Compatibility** The part number (R911317709-07) is a known replacement for the HT-S11 servo drive, meaning it should fit and function as intended in the original system with minimal modifications.
4. **Availability** New Rexroth/Bosch components can have long lead times, whereas used or refurbished units may be available immediately, reducing operational delays.
5. **Environmental Benefit** Reusing components reduces electronic waste, aligning with sustainability efforts in industrial maintenance.
#### **Cons**
1. **Unknown History** Without full documentation or testing, the board may have hidden defects, such as damaged traces, failed capacitors, or wear from previous use, leading to premature failure.
2. **Warranty Limitations** Used or refurbished parts typically come with limited or no warranty, exposing the buyer to potential repair costs if issues arise shortly after purchase.
3. **Compatibility Risks** Even if the part number matches, slight variations in firmware, calibration, or mechanical connections could cause integration problems, requiring additional troubleshooting.
4. **Lack of Support** Bosch/Rexroth may not provide official support for used components, leaving the buyer to rely on third-party technicians or forums for diagnostics.
5. **Potential for Counterfeit Parts** The market for used industrial components can include fakes or mislabeled parts, which may not function correctly or could damage the servo system.
6. **Testing Requirements** Before installation, the board must be thoroughly tested (e.g., signal integrity checks, motor compatibility, and communication protocols) to ensure it meets operational standards.

### **Recommendation**
1. **Verify the Source** Purchase from a reputable supplier with a track record of selling tested or refurbished industrial components. Request documentation (e.g., test reports, replacement history) to confirm the board s condition.
2. **Professional Inspection** Have an experienced technician or automation specialist inspect the board for physical damage, signal integrity, and compatibility with the servo drive s firmware. Consider bench-testing it with a known-good motor and controller.
3. **Warranty or Guarantee** If possible, seek a supplier offering a limited warranty (e.g., 30 90 days) or a money-back guarantee to reduce financial risk.
4. **Compare with New Options** If the budget allows, weigh the cost of the used board against the price of a new or remanufactured OEM part, factoring in long-term reliability and support.
5. **Backup Plan** Keep spare capacitors, connectors, or a backup board on hand in case the used unit fails shortly after installation.
6. **Avoid Unverified Sellers** Be cautious of listings with vague descriptions, no return policy, or sellers who refuse to provide testing details. Prioritize sellers with transparent processes.
**Final Verdict:** A used Rexroth Indramat HT-S11 circuit board can be a viable purchase if sourced carefully, tested rigorously, and integrated with proper safeguards. However, it is not without risk, and buyers should approach the transaction with due diligence to avoid costly failures. For mission-critical applications, a new or remanufactured part may be the safer long-term investment.
